Results on Existence and Controllability of Caputo Fractional Neutral Integro-Differential Equations

This chapter, focused on fractional neutral integro-differential structures with state-dependent delay in Banach spaces, building from semigroups, fractional calculus and the Banach contraction principle. Our proceeding hypothesis assume that the functions defining the equation meet specific Lipschitz conditions. The fractional equations in the time domain consider derivatives in the range of \(\nu \in (0, 1)\) . Theoretical and numerical outcomes are discussed using different input terms introduced in the fractional equation. The examples are discussed for showing the application of the outcomes developed.
